        <title>
            Crucifix on police badges &#039;a fossil&#039;: politician
        </title>
        <description>
            An local politician from the Spanish north-African enclave of Ceuta has requested police badges without a crucifix should be available for police officers who want them, calling the symbol of the cross &quot;a fossil&quot;.
